Suprisingly and also in certain extend suspicously, Belgium, Austria and the Swiss were the only hosts (all being co-hosts) who didn't make the semi-finals.

Up until the Euro 1976 hosts had to qualify to the top 4 to the tournament that they themselves had prepared (of course only 4 teams went to the finals), but never did any of the host not make it to the semis.

I'm sure there would have been issues about co-hosting the tournament in which the results are clear that a weaker link gets a spot, but I wonder how a host had not a single time failed to qualify during those qualification must years namely from 1960~1976 (France, Spain, Italy, Belgium, Yugoslavia).
